Subject:   How to use unrecognized COM port card?
Message-ID:  <4E4A0C81.7020501@rawbw.com>

next in thread | raw e-mail | index | archive | help
I have dual COM port pci card:
none7@pci0:8:1:0:       class=0x070002 card=0x32534348 chip=0x32534348 
rev=0x10 hdr=0x00
     class      = simple comms
     subclass   = UART
     bar   [10] = type I/O Port, range 32, base 0xe880, size  8, enabled
     bar   [14] = type I/O Port, range 32, base 0xe800, size  8, enabled

Manufacturer 0x4348 isn't recognized by http://www.pcidatabase.com. It 
was purchased from China through ebay.

How to make it to work in 8.2-STABLE?
